Ao Oni game variant
Players: 12
Teams: 3
Reds: 3
Greens: 6
Onis: 3

Blues being used: Psychic, Seer, Guardian

Onis role: Normal Oni, blockman Oni, shadow Oni.

Win conditions:
Reds: keep the game until Day 5
Greens: eliminate all Onis
Onis: have the ratio between greens and onis to a 1:1 ratio.

Special items: shed key, rope ladder, flashlight
Shed key for reds win
Rope ladder for greens victory
Flashlight for randomized night phase (acts like a drunk seer, reds would read green, greens would read red, onis will be random)

Cardflipping: off
TWG or jTWG: TWG

Sorry for short post, posting from tablet >_>

more details on the win conditions: There is a possibility that two teams can win this game, but that is if by a stroke of luck if either the greens/onis find the reds and form up an alliance to win. But, if the reds die off, the game goes on past day 5 (if needed) as none of the conditions for the greens or onis indicate that they needs to kill the reds in order to win, that means that the reds are in risk of being killed in the night phases along eith the greens, but the onis are in risk of being kidnapped by the reds.

12 players:

three wolves.
9 humans.

dynamic roles.

Everyone has two things: an inactive role and a partner. Roles rotate and are randomized every phase. So, Player X has Player Y as a partner. Player X knows what his role is but cannot use it unless Player Y tells the host he allows the role to be activated. All partners are randomized so humans can have wolf partners. Wolves can have human partners. Partners are not dynamic. They do not change upon death.

Players have the option of guessing who each players' partners are. Players who guess correctly by sending a PM to the host are rewarded with permanent powers in exchange for the death of the player they sent a PM about. So if Player Z guessed that Player X's partner is Player Y, Player Z is rewarded with Player X's role for that phase regardless if it was activated by Player Y or not. Player X dies. If Player Z guesses incorrectly, though, he forfeits his ability to receive or activate roles for the rest of the game.

Players whose roles have been activated seer BLUE. So reds can seer blue. Greens can seer blue.

my game is designed to organically incentivize activity. Without speaking to other players humans lose.

I'm rotating 16 roles that any player, including wolves, could use if activated by their partners. Wolves do not have a MW but they can seer blue if their powers are activated. The question is, if you don't trust your partner or the player that whose role you activate, will you be able to rely on them?

for instance, you're green and got a psychic role. Imagine the discussion right now is centered around the number of wolves left alive. You know that with the psychic role you can know for sure how many wolves are left alive, but your partner is the only player who can allow you to get that role. Your partner is also a wolf. Will the wolf allow you to have that role? will he deny you that opportunity? if he doesn't, will he kill you? If you suspect that, will you risk telling other people who your partner is knowing that someone could kill you if they tell the host they know who your partner is?

The same works in the reverse. Imagine you're red and you just got a vigi role. You want it for two reasons: you might be able to use it to kill two people and you'll seer blue, not red. Your partner, a human, might ask you who you're going to kill? He could refuse to give you the role because if you're green what's the problem?
